Output 8e085970fa0757b3d6219320d53b6b246b0c2edaaecdcca7cc827b5581dfbf32:0

value
1221602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f84f7f5c35685eb4bdf5ab4f25d88a35dd67f8 OP_EQUAL
address
33RKYv3GXjRn2hgdKtWsSQi62U1VHbqVBN
transaction
8e085970fa0757b3d6219320d53b6b246b0c2edaaecdcca7cc827b5581dfbf32
confirmations
330521
spent
true